Common Welder’s Certifications
Although the AWS’ standard CW certification opens the door for the majority of employment opportunities, some fields will require their certain certification. Examples of the most-popular of these are highlighted below.
- American Petroleum Institute Certification for welders that work with pipelines in the energy industry
- ASME Certification for those that deal with boiler and pressure vessels
- CWI and SCWI Certification for inspectors and senior inspectors
- CW Credentials to become a Certified Welder

The below graphic displays earnings and labor estimates for professional welders in Pennsylvania through 2022.
| Pennsylvania | Employment |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 2022 | Change | Annual Job Openings |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ers | 15,910 | 16,780 | 5% | 480 |
| Pennsylvania | Annual Salary | ||
|---|---|---|---|
| Low | Median | High |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ers |
$26,400 | $37,600 | $54,500 |
Source: O*Net Online
